OpenMetadata is an open-source metadata management and data catalog platform providing discovery, governance, lineage, and data quality across the modern data stack.
OpenMetadata is an open-source metadata management platform that provides data catalog, data discovery, data lineage, data quality, and data governance capabilities through a single unified metadata store, designed to serve as the central metadata layer for the modern data stack across cloud data warehouses, ETL pipelines, BI tools, ML platforms, and operational databases. The platform's architecture is built on a metadata API layer that aggregates metadata from connected data sources into a centralized repository with a standardized schema, enabling search and discovery across the full data environment without requiring each tool to be queried separately. OpenMetadata's open-source foundation means that organizations can deploy the platform without vendor licensing costs and can extend or customize the platform for specific use cases by contributing to or forking the codebase — an important consideration for data engineering teams that need to adapt catalog functionality to match their specific data stack configuration.

Dataland is a New York-based no-code collaborative data management platform — backed by Y Combinator (W20) with funding from South Park Commons and Switch Ventures — providing business teams with a spreadsheet-like interface for centralizing, structuring, and automating business data workflows without SQL expertise, generating $1 million in revenue in 2024 with a 5-9 person team. Received an M&A offer in April 2025, positioning as a competitive alternative to Airtable and Notion in the growing no-code database market.
